Super Bowl: Carrie Underwood's sound check National Anthem better

carrie-underwood-natl-anthem-320.jpgCarrie Underwood's practice National Anthem was much better than the actual performance.

Did you see Carrie do the Star-Spangled Banner at the Super Bowl? Looking like an extra from Dollywood? It was a little rough. We all know Carrie can sing, so we were a little surprised when her National Anthem didn't floor us.

However, based on this video of her sound check, we now have to chalk it up to nerves or maybe she couldn't hear herself as well with a stadium full of people. Either way, we wanted to put this out there because the sound check National Anthem? Nailed it. And we do give her props for singing it live because it is NOT an easy song to sing.




What do you think? Do you prefer sound check Carrie or Dollywood Carrie? We love Carrie either way, but the relaxed-plaid-shirt-in-the-rain Carrie is the Carrie we love most.

They couldn't hear themselves. The first thing Queen Latifah did was yank the monitor feed out of her ear, which probably means it was actually giving her the wrong signal. In a big open stadium your voice would only be audible to you in bad delay through the stadium speakers. In Miami today, there's probably a sound man looking for a new job.
